Posting your own review under a pseudonym is a bad idea, dishonest, and 99% of people who do it are so obvious about it that they end up getting called out which only makes things worse.

Dishonesty is a bad way to repair or start a new relationship.

If anything you post as the new owner, introduce yourself and pledge that none of the previous bad experiences will happen going forward and ask them to come in and give you a chance to prove it.
